Vinnies garage sale returns Saturday
1 min read

THE Vinnies Gawler monthly garage sale returns this Saturday, August 1, at its warehouse on Howard Street, after months of COVID-19 restrictions forced its closure earlier in the year.

Warehouse manager Des Wallace said while it will be great to start getting rid of everything piling up, it’s also a chance for the Vinnie’s community to come back together.

“Ever since we had to stop we’ve been hearing from all our regulars ‘when are you doing the garage sales again’, so it’s fair to say they’re all looking forward to it,” he said.

“We have a lot of young families come through, as well as collectors, and dealers all looking for a bargain… it also operates a bit like a men’s shed in a way.

“(The men here) are all retired, and it’s an outing for us every Monday, Tuesday and Thursday when we operate here, and the blokes look forward to it – so it’s a social gathering for us as well.”

With the garage sale set to clear out space in the warehouse, Vinnies will be resuming its furniture pick-up and delivery service, where it provides furniture for people in need, such as domestic violence victims. Mr Wallace also pointed out that the garage sale is a primary source of the charity’s fundraising efforts, making it a crucial part of the operation.

“It’s really the only fundraiser that we have,” he said.

“That money all get spent back here locally, too. It all goes towards the food parcels we make, clothing donations, vouchers, and more. It goes to the areas dedicated to people in need, so it’s great to have it back up and running.”

The garage sale kicks off at 7.30am and runs through the morning.
